Output c51f558a178685f037aef14d15028a61d67d3d2d85c0e4715f2bc8aadb671c7f:0

value
767700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ccbe442f5fd9512838b02e8faefaf5f79acaf7 OP_EQUAL
address
32DgaK3573CSv3R7WysDwXNCnj2J46E85h
transaction
c51f558a178685f037aef14d15028a61d67d3d2d85c0e4715f2bc8aadb671c7f
confirmations
40320
spent
true